Before we go any further, it will be advantageous to just remind ourselves what actually causes snoring at night, so that we can better appreciate how devices like the snoring chin strap are able to relieve snoring...
You don't snore when you're awake, only when you are sleeping. Ever wondered why this is? Well, it's because, during sleep, your whole body relaxes, including the muscles and tissue in your airways. And because you are asleep you have no control over this happening, as you have when you are awake.
They can relax to such an extent that, depending on a number of other considerations, they can fall into your airways and partially block them. This leaves your airways with a much restricted area for the air to flow through as you breathe during sleep.
These are the kind of conditions that can turn smooth airflow into turbulent airflow. The soft tissue that is partially blocking your airways then vibrate due to this turbulence. It's these vibrations that produce the sounds of snoring.
Now, as I mentioned above, there are other considerations to take into account when snoring, things like your weight, whether you ate a very late meal, whether you had alcohol before bed, if you sleep on your back, do you have nasal allergies, etc. And, by tackling these other issues you can also treat your snoring problem.
But, even taking those into account, a core reason for snoring may be that as you sleep your lower jaw drops away from your top jaw. And, especially if you prefer to sleep on your back, this can put pressure on your throat and allow your tongue to fall backwards, restricting your airway even more. If you could prevent this happening, then your chances of snoring would be diminished.
And this is where the snoring chin strap comes in. By wearing it at night, your chin (lower jaw) is supported in its proper place so that it doesn't drop and neither does your tongue, which is attached to your lower jaw. And the aid is comfortable to wear and not obtrusive. All leading to a good night's sleep and no snoring, or, at the very least much less snoring.
